Transaction 28307094de84f0bd4d870cfd2b1a57c8763083569ffb42a14509c298b0a79859

1 Input
2 Outputs
  • 28307094de84f0bd4d870cfd2b1a57c8763083569ffb42a14509c298b0a79859:0
  • value  563039290
    address  2N3dfcnDp3QqUYkiUeYV3xSuzbNox6NJkUK
  • 28307094de84f0bd4d870cfd2b1a57c8763083569ffb42a14509c298b0a79859:1
  • value  2686824
    address  2N6tD6EWzTakpTUTTX3M76W5GzNfsMfsRfz